3 Easy Meal Prep Snacks

  1. Cheezy Garlic Herb Popcorn

Popcorn is one of the best crunchy snacks! Plus, it is actually really high in fiber, which helps digestion. I use a special seasoning blend on this popcorn which gives it a wonderfully cheesy flavor, without the cheese. Pairing this cheesy flavor with that savory bite of garlic powder and the deep, herbal scent of oregano, this popcorn is seriously addictive! To make this a completely vegan snack, substitute the dairy butter for a non-dairy butter or even, coconut oil.

2. Cherry Almond Protein Bars

These protein bars, are the ones that I get the most compliments on! I have served them at several events and have always gotten such awesome feedback from people!

Almond Cherry Protein Bars Stacked

I love the combination of the chewy dried cherries and the crunch from the almonds. That contrast in texture and flavor keeps you coming back for one more bite. And maybe another... and another....

Pro tip: to make these protein bars a little easier to travel with, you can also shape them into balls.

3. Roasted Nuts with Rosemary, Garlic and Ancho Chili

I recently made these perfectly golden, crunchy and aromatic nuts for a party, and a girlfriend of mine took the whole bowl from the buffet so she could finish them!

These roasted nuts have so much delicious flavor but they couldn't be simpler to make. You just need one bowl and few ingredients that you probably have in your pantry right now.

Once the nuts have roasted and cooled, you can easily package them into single servings and place in several resealable bags. Then you can easily grab them and run out the door to whatever event you have happening next.
